You're Exercising. You're Trying Hard. So Why Does Your Body Feel
Worse, Not Better?

"Just exercise more."

If I had a dollar for every time a woman in perimenopause or menopause told me that's what she was advised ...

I'd have retired by now.

Here's the truth that most generic advice misses:

For many women during menopause, "just exercise more" with the
wrong approach can actually make things harder not easier.

More high-intensity training can raise cortisol, which disrupts sleep
and increases hot flash frequency.

More impact and pressure on the pelvic floor can worsen leakage
and pelvic discomfort.

More inflammation from overtraining can increase joint pain, fatigue, and recovery time.

This is not an argument against movement.

Movement is one of the most powerful menopause support tools available.

But it has to be the RIGHT kind of movement for WHERE YOU ARE right now - not just "more."

That's the difference between punishing your body and supporting it.

Your body hasn't failed you.
Your movement plan just needs to catch up to where your body actually is.

Try This 10-Minute Wind-Down Tonight. Women Are Sleeping Better By Morning.

10 minutes tonight that could genuinely change how you sleep this week.

This is the breathing and wind-down approach I share with women navigating menopause sleep disruption.

It takes 10 minutes.
No equipment.
No supplements required to start.

Here it is:

STEP 1 - Cool your environment (2 min.

Open a window slightly, turn on a fan, or remove a layer before bed. Your body needs to drop in temperature to enter deep sleep this is even more important during menopause.

STEP 2 - Calm Core breathing (5 min)

Breathe in slowly through your nose for 4 counts. Out through your mouth for 6 counts. Repeat this 10 times. This activates your parasympathetic nervous system - your body's natural "rest and restore" signal.

STEP 3 - One quiet thought (3 min)

Before you close your eyes, write down or mentally name ONE thing that felt okay today. Not perfect. Just okay.

This simple step quiets the mental chatter that keeps many women with menopause awake long after the hot flash has passed.

That's it.
